GSH reports jump in 3Q earnings to S$7.3m on revenue contribution from maiden KL project

The Edge Singapore
12 November, 2019
Updated:about 6 years ago

SINGAPORE (Nov 12): Property group GSH Corporation saw its earnings more than treble to S$7.3 million for 3Q19 ended September, from S$2.1 million a year ago.

This translated to earnings per share of 0.370 (Singaporean) cents for 3Q19, compared to 0.107 cents in 3Q18.

3Q revenue jumped 63.7% to S$45.9 million, from S$28.0 million a year ago.

This was mainly due to a surge in contributions from its property business, as a result of the progressive recognition of sales from Eaton Residences, the group’s maiden project in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.
